What Beasts Can You Breed?
Out of the 13 Beasts present in Hogwarts Legacy, 12 Beasts can be bred. The Phoenix is the only species in the game that can't be bred because it's a one-of-a-kind creature. In a quest given to you by Deek called "Phoenix Rising," you'll be tasked with catching a Phoenix.
How to Breed Beasts in Hogwarts Legacy
Once you've unlocked the Room of Requirement and obtained the Nab-Sack, you'll need to complete the "Foal of the Dead" side quest which is given to you by Deek. This quest will have you capture a Thestral to bring back to the Vivarium in the Room of Requirement. You'll also need to obtain a Breeding Pen Spellcraft which can be bought from Tomes and Scrolls in Hogsmeade for 1,000 gold.
Head to the Room of Requirement and into the Vivarium and conjure up a breeding pen by using your Conjuration spell. Place both a male and female Beast of the same species and wait 30 minutes in real-time to produce an offspring. And that's it! Remember that every Beast in the game can be bred except the Phoenix.
